Output 5b4eab56e98df63043e2b2e09d8a41da760284dda3db0a4cb819b5b2a9bfede0:0

value
69988251
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d94f93a79fd5bcdb191e428c0cd309afcb88a67f OP_EQUAL
address
3MW3tGAgtgAA8tME6qyRDnPdVuWxBoWk1G
transaction
5b4eab56e98df63043e2b2e09d8a41da760284dda3db0a4cb819b5b2a9bfede0
confirmations
485121
spent
true